Conceptuality of Donbass: frames of ideological and political content and cognitive of development strategies

https://doi.org/10.22394/2079-1690-2023-1-1-205-210

Abstract

The current geopolitical turbulence, in which our country is located, requires comprehension of several key topics and concepts that are used as the basis for the formation for the formation  of Russian-Ukrainian relations, one of such complex concepts is the Donbass. Based on the totality of  the theory of political conceptology, cognitive strategies and frames, the article analyzes the specifics and vision of Donbass, identifies groups of the most relevant submissions about the historical features and  the current state of the concept of Donbass. The authors come to the conclusion that it is necessary to  dive deeper into the philosophical and political discourse of the key ideas and values of the modern  confrontation.
